Cloth Mother
A reference to the surrogate mother experiment in psychology, where infant monkeys showed a preference for a cloth-covered surrogate mother over a wire mesh surrogate that provided food.
Wire Mother
An experiment in developmental psychology by Harry Harlow, exploring attachment by showing that infant monkeys preferred soft, cloth surrogates over wire ones, even if the latter provided food.
Sensory Restriction
A condition or experimental setup where the amount or type of sensory input is limited or controlled to investigate its effects on the mind or behavior.
